Página 284 - The logarithm of a number is the exponent of the power to which it is necessary to raise a fixed number, in order to produce the first number.
Página 258 - We may obtain the sixth root by extracting the cube root of the square root, or the square root of the cube root. It is, however, best to extract the roots of the lowest degrees first, because the operation is less laborious. We may obtain the eighth root by extracting the square root three times successively.

Página 38 - The square of the sum of two quantities is equal to the square of the first, plus twice the product of the first by the second, plus the square of the second.
Página 101 - RULE. Find an expression for the value of one of the unknown quantities in one of the equations, and substitute this value for the same unknown quantity in the other equation.
Página 139 - Which proves that the square of a number composed of tens and units contains, the square of the tens plus twice the product of the tens by the units, plus the square of the units.
